WebSolar cycles are nearly periodic 11-year changes in the Sun's activity that are based on the number of sunspots present on the Sun's surface. The first solar cycle conventionally is said to have started in 1755 when Rudolf Wolf began extensive reporting of sunspot activity. The source data are the revised International Sunspot Numbers (ISN v2.0), as available at SILSO.
